Python 业务部署
在现代的软件开发过程中,部署是非常重要的一个环节。部署是将开发完成的软件应用程序放到服务器上运行的过程,保证应用程序能够正常运行并提供服务。Python 作为一种流行的编程语言,也需要进行业务部署。本文将介绍 Python 业务部署的相关知识,并给出代码示例。
Python 业务部署流程
Python 业务部署一般包括以下几个步骤:
-
准备环境:在部署之前需要确保目标服务器已经安装了 Python 运行环境,并且安装了所需的依赖包。
-
上传代码:将开发完成的 Python 代码上传到服务器的指定目录。
-
配置环境变量:设置环境变量,指定 Python 程序的入口文件。
-
启动应用程序:运行 Python 程序,监听指定的端口,等待客户端请求。
Python 业务部署示例
下面是一个简单的 Python Flask 应用程序示例,展示了如何进行业务部署:
from flask import Flask
app = Flask(__name__)
@app.route('/')
def hello_world():
return 'Hello, World!'
if __name__ == '__main__':
app.run()
在这个示例中,我们使用 Flask 框架创建了一个简单的 Web 应用程序,当用户访问根路径时,返回"Hello, World!"。
Python 业务部署甘特图示例
下面是一个使用 mermaid 语法绘制的 Python 业务部署甘特图示例:
gantt
title Python 业务部署甘特图
section 准备环境
准备环境: done, 2022-01-01, 1d
section 上传代码
上传代码: done, after 准备环境, 2d
section 配置环境变量
配置环境变量: done, after 上传代码, 1d
section 启动应用程序
启动应用程序: done, after 配置环境变量, 1d
以上就是关于 Python 业务部署的简要介绍和示例代码。通过以上步骤,我们可以成功将 Python 应用程序部署到服务器上,为用户提供服务。希望本文对您有所帮助!